deltas: skip if projected delta size is bigger than previous snapshot

Before computing any delta, we get a basic estimation of the delta size we can
expect and the resulted compressed value. We then checks this projected size
against the `size(snapshotⁿ) > size(snapshotⁿ⁺¹)` constraint. This allows to
exclude potential base candidates before doing any expensive computation.

This only apply to the intermediate-snapshot case since this constraint only
apply to them.

For some pathological cases of a private repository this step provide a
significant performance boost (timing from `hg perfrevlogwrite`):

before: 14.115908 seconds
after:   3.145906 seconds
